Intro
Creating a TikTok-like application is a lucrative venture in the fast-evolving landscape of digital platforms. Short-format media is becoming the preferred type for entertainment and communication across the globe. The TikTok platform, with its advanced recommendation systems and engaging tools, has become a global trend, reshaping the way individuals engage with content.
As an innovator or company leader, the opportunity to develop a short-video application that takes advantage of this success can generate substantial growth. This article will instruct you on ways to build an app that not only competes with TikTok but also differentiates itself, guaranteeing success in a challenging market.
Understanding the Popularity of TikTok-Like Platforms
TikTok is recognized as a leading player in the social media world, with over 1 billion active users in the year 2024. The platform’s primary draw lies in its engaging quick video format and its algorithm-driven feed, which keeps users engaged for significant amounts of time. The app’s popularity can be attributed to its ability to personalize content, enable widespread video sharing, and serve both individual creators and corporate entities.
This combination makes similar apps attractive not just to users, but also to advertisers, influencers, and content creators, who view the platform as a effective medium for reaching target demographics.
For anyone looking to build a TikTok clone app, analyzing the attraction of TikTok and similar apps is crucial. Concise video formats are highly time-efficient, very easy to distribute, and easy to create with minimal equipment. Whether it's creative performances, humorous acts, learning materials, or brand promotions, the medium offers diverse potential for viewer connection. A replica app needs to emphasize these key principles, offering seamless usability for both content creators and viewers.
Define the Core Features of Your TikTok Clone App
Creating a video-sharing platform requires a robust set of core features that mirror TikTok’s strengths and introduce original elements. These functionalities should prioritize user engagement, facilitate seamless video production, and inter-user connections. Here’s a summary of the essential features for your app:
Account Creation and Personalization:
Ensure easy registration for users. Allow users to sign up via multiple convenient options. Features for personalizing profiles, like adding a bio or profile picture, enhance user interaction.
Advanced Video Features:
One of the key elements that differentiates TikTok is its built-in video editor. Be certain that your app provides advanced video customization tools, such as interactive editing features and music synchronization.
Custom Video Suggestions:
The success of TikTok is largely driven by its content recommendation algorithm. Incorporating advanced algorithms to curate tailored content based on engagement metrics like likes and shares keeps users hooked.
Community Engagement Tools:
Basic social features like comments and likes are necessary to creating a connected user base. Users need options for join popular challenges, engage with others, and explore a wide range of videos.
Real-Time Interaction:
Including a live streaming feature lets users connect with their followers in live settings. This introduces a dynamic dimension to the app, enriching the user experience and content variety.
Profit-Generating Features:
Consider how your TikTok clone app will generate revenue. You can include video ads, microtransactions for special tools, and brand collaborations. Providing a hub for influencer marketing will add a significant revenue stream.
By prioritizing essential functionalities, you create the basis for a profitable short-video application.
Emphasize Seamless Interaction
Design and user experience (UX) play a vital role in the growth of any content-sharing application. The app must allow easy navigation, consume content, add videos, and connect socially. A user-friendly layout keeps users engaged and lowers attrition rates.
For your short-form video platform, focus on optimizing for mobile users, as the majority of interactions happen on phones. Focus on these key interface attributes:
Streamlined Interface: Design the app’s interface is easy to navigate. The main feed should take priority, with clearly marked icons for posting content, leaving feedback, and exploring.
Adaptive Layouts: The app needs to adapt to all screen dimensions, as viewers access from multiple platforms.
Fast Load Times: To retain attention, content must stream without delays. Incorporate advanced caching techniques and opt for distributed servers to accelerate loading.
Pick the Best Development Frameworks
Deciding on the appropriate tech foundation for your application is critical for achieving growth, reliability, and a seamless user experience. Here’s a overview of recommended tools:
Frontend Development:
Consider cross-platform frameworks for cross-platform development, which supports diverse operating systems with a consistent approach. These frameworks streamline development, budget-friendly, and simple to support.
Database and Logic:
For the server logic, select scalable platforms like Node.js or Django. These tools offer speed, handle increasing traffic, and support extensive video and user workflows.
Video Hosting Solutions:
Efficient video hosting is essential. Leverage reliable cloud providers, which ensure safe video storage and maintain consistent playback.
AI & Machine Learning:
To personalize content feeds, integrate AI and machine learning algorithms. These technologies study viewer activity, curating feeds that resonate with their habits.
By investing in Analytics tools suitable technologies, you set up your app for success.
Enhance User Experience with Smart Algorithms
An essential aspect behind TikTok’s success lies in its advanced AI capabilities to curate individualized feeds. By analyzing user activity—such as content preferences, time spent, and shares—the app creates personalized video feeds, increasing usage time.
For your similar application, utilizing intelligent systems helps create that the videos is aligned with audience tastes. Here’s how AI can benefit your platform:
Recommendation Engine:
Using advanced AI models, your app automatically identifies content users are likely to enjoy.
Popular Media Highlights:
AI can identify content that is gaining traction and promotes it across user feeds, helping popular content reach more users.
Implement Revenue Models
Creating a revenue-generating platform demands a focus on income streams; earning revenue is key to ensuring long-term success. Here are several monetization strategies to help your app generate revenue:
In-App Advertisements:
Collaborate with ad platforms to place interactive ads strategically. Ad revenue can be a significant source of income for free users.
Brand Collaborations:
Taking inspiration from leading platforms, provide tools for brand interaction and sponsor challenges or influencer campaigns. This will appeal to companies looking to promote their products.
Premium Features:
Provide paid enhancements for creators, allowing users to pay to enhance their content creation experience.
Subscription Models:
Provide a subscription option for users who want an ad-free experience or gaining premium privileges. This regular income stream provides predictable cash flow.
Focus on Virality and User Growth
Promoting viral content distribution helps expand your audience for your TikTok clone app. Add tools that allow seamless cross-posting on multiple social networks. Social sharing creates a viral loop, where users spread content, expanding your user base.
In addition to social sharing, integrate engagement boosters such as:
Challenges:
Allow users to create and participate in video challenges, a core feature of TikTok. This generates user-created content and ensures constant activity.
Categorization Tools:
Introduce organized tagging to make content easily findable, boosting discoverability.
By optimizing social sharing, you ensure constant audience expansion.
Prioritize Data Protection
Like all interactive applications, data safety are essential. With the increasing concern over user data, your application must meet global security requirements such as international privacy laws and CCPA (California Consumer Privacy Act).
Add these safeguards to protect user information:
Encryption:
Secure sensitive data with encryption protocols like SSL/TLS to prevent unauthorized access.
User Verification Features:
Add an extra layer of security to user accounts by enabling multi-factor verification. This bolsters user confidence.
Secure Payments:
For platforms with monetization features, use trusted payment processors. This builds trust with users.
Leverage Influencers and Partnerships for Growth
Content creators serve as major catalysts in driving engagement and increasing downloads. Building partnerships with creators in your industry can generate organic growth and trustworthiness to your brand.
To successfully leverage influencers:
Target Niche Influencers:
Focus on creators whose audience matches your target demographic.
Run Sponsored Campaigns:
Allow influencers to showcase app features or run paid campaigns to increase awareness.
Offer Incentives:
Offer creators rewards like financial compensation, premium app tools, or visibility opportunities to secure loyalty.
Track Success Metrics
Once your video-sharing application is operational, it’s critical to frequently analyze and improve its user experience. Adopt tracking solutions like industry-standard analytics platforms to gather performance data, such as:
Onboarding Rates:
Track how new users are discovering your app to maximize reach.
Activity Monitoring:
Measure how often users interact with content. High interactivity show platform success.
Churn Analysis:
Analyze user retention over time to identify areas for improvement.
Regularly analyze these metrics to identify areas for improvement. Split testing optimizes user interfaces, ensuring your app evolves with user needs.
Conclusion: Unlocking the Potential of Your TikTok Clone App
Creating a successful short-video application requires careful planning, but done correctly, it can be highly rewarding. By focusing on user engagement, enhancing experiences with AI, offering a seamless user experience, and building robust revenue models, you build a platform that thrives and delivers financial success.
Begin Your Journey Today!
Are you ready to take the leap and build your own TikTok clone app? The path to growth lies in offering unique features, optimizing user experience, and continuously evolving your platform based on user feedback. Quick, engaging content dominates Search engine ranking the digital age, and by implementing these steps, your app has the potential to succeed.